Area of Science:

  • Obstetrics and Gynecology
  • Neonatology
  • Biochemistry

Context:

  • High-risk pregnancies, including those with diabetes, premature rupture of membranes, hypertension, intrauterine growth retardation, and twin gestations, require accurate fetal lung maturity assessment.
  • Amniotic fluid analysis provides a biochemical window into fetal development.

Purpose:

  • To evaluate the efficacy of two biochemical methods, FLM-TDX Abbott and phosphatidylglycerol (PG) determination, for assessing fetal lung maturity.
  • To determine the correlation between these biochemical markers and the risk of hyaline membrane disease (HMD).

Summary:

  • 166 amniotic fluid samples were analyzed using FLM-TDX Abbott and PG tests.
  • Fetal lung maturity was defined as a phospholipid rate >50 mg/g albumin (FLM-TDX Abbott), with or without PG presence.

  • PG was detected only after 35 weeks of gestation.
  • Significant variability in FLM-TDX values was observed across different gestational ages.
  • In a subset of 30 neonates, FLM-TDX values <30 were associated with HMD, while a value of 52 was observed in one HMD case.
  • Impact:

    • The FLM-TDX Abbott test is confirmed as a reliable tool for assessing fetal lung maturity.
    • The test's utility is independent of gestational age, offering a valuable diagnostic aid.
    • Accurate fetal lung maturity assessment can guide clinical decisions and potentially reduce the incidence of HMD.
